This series makes a few final prepatory changes, and then replaces almost all of the board specific code with generic alternatives. The end result is that all Qualcomm boards both current and future (with the exception of the db410c and db820c) can be supported by a single U-Boot binary by just providing the correct DT. New boards can be added without introducing any addition mach/ or board/ code or config options. Due to the nature of this change, the patch ("mach-snapdragon: generalise board support") has become pretty big, I tried a few different ways to represent this in git history, but the other methods (e.g. adding a stub "generic" target and removing it again) were more confusing and made for much messier git history. The current patch is mostly atomic, but requires regenerating the config. The QCS404 EVB board had some code to enable the USB VBUS regulator, this is dropped in favour of a adding a new vbus-supply property to the dwc3-generic driver. This will also be used by the dragonboard845c in a future patch. This handles the common case of a board requiring some regulator be enabled for USB host mode. A more detailed description of the changes is below. == Memory map == The memory map was historically hardcoded into U-Boot, this meant that U-Boot had to be built for a specific variant of a device. This is changed to instead read the memory map from the DT /memory node. Additionally, most boards mapped addresss 0x0 as valid, as a result if a null pointer access happens then it will cause a bus stall (and board hang). This is fixed so that null pointer accesses will now correctly throw an exception. == DT loading == Previously, boards used the FDT blob embedded into U-Boot (via OF_SEPARATE). However, most Qualcomm boards run U-Boot as a secondary bootloader, so we can instead rely on the first-stage bootloader to populate some useful FDT properties for us (notably the /memory node and KASLR seed) and fetch the DTB that it provides. Combined with the memory map changes above, this let's us entirely avoid configuring the memory map explicitly. == defconfig == Most of the board defconfigs and config headers were quite similar, to simplify maintenance going forward, all the fully generic boards (sdm845 and qcs404-evb so far) are adapted to use the new qcom_defconfig. Going forward, all new Qualcomm boards should be supported by this defconfig. A notable exception is for specific usecases (like U-Boot as the primary bootloader). == The older dragonboards == The db410c and db820c both have some custom board init code, as a result they aren't yet binary compatible. mach-snapdragon is adjusted so that all the necessary config options (e.g. CONFIG_SYS_BOARD) can be set from their defconfigs, this makes it possible to enable support for new boards without introducing additional config options. The db410c can run U-Boot either chainloaded like the other boards, or as a first-stage bootloader replacing aboot. However it was hardcoded to only build for the latter option. This series introduces a new "chainloaded" defconfig to enable easier testing via fastboot. == dynamic environment variables == This series also introduces runtime-allocated load addresses via the lmb allocator. This allows for booting on boards with vastly different memory layouts without any pre-calculation or macro magic in the config header. This feature is based on similar code in mach-apple. The soc, board, and fdtfile environment variables are also generated automatically. Many Qualcomm boards follow a similar scheme for DTB naming such that the name can often be derived from the root compatible properties. This is intended to cover the most common cases and be a simple solution for booting generic distro images without having to explicitly choose the right DTB. The U-Boot DTS can be tweaked if necessary to produce the correct name, the variable can be overwritten, or a bootloader like GRUB can load the devicetree instead. == Upstream DT == All Qualcomm boards have had their devicetree files replaced with the upstream versions. Previous patch series made the necessary driver adjustments to fully support the upstream DT format. All future Qualcomm boards should use upstream DTS by default. Once Sumit's work to import dt-rebasing has been merged, we will drop the imported DT and bindings again.
